Compare Worcester to Lowell

This post compares Worcester, Massachusetts to Lowell, Massachusetts across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Worcester (city) Lowell (city)
Population 184,743 110,964
Income (median) $45,149 $42,675
Home Value (median) $210,600 $240,500
White 69% 60%
Black 13% 7%
Asian 7% 21%
With Kids 27% 33%
Age (median) 34 33
Rentals 57% 57%
